Efficacy of Two Types of Noninvasive Nerve Stimulation in the Management of Myofascial Pain Caused by Temporomandibular Joint (TMJ) Disorders.

Abstract

Background A range of diseases affecting the jaw muscles and/or temporomandibular joint are referred to as temporomandibular disorders (TMDs). Nearly 80% of the general population is affected by TMDs, and 48% of those people have trouble opening their mouths and have painful muscles. Aim To compare the effectiveness of transcutaneous electrical nerve stimulation (TENS) and microcurrent nerve stimulation (MENS) for the relief of masticatory muscle discomfort. Methods Groups I and II were further separated into two groups of 30 persons each (A and B), as well as subgroups C and D. Subjects in Group I received TENS treatment for 20 minutes at frequencies of 0-5 and 5-5 for subgroups A and B, and with visual analog scale (VAS) scores of 1-5 and 6-10 for subgroups C and D, respectively. Subjects in Group II received MENS for 20 minutes, with subgroups C and D receiving the same frequency and VAS score as subgroups A and B, respectively. All individuals underwent treatment with a comparable frequency and length of time every day for five days. Results For subgroup D treated with MENS, there was a considerable reduction in pain; however, for subgroups A and C, there was a comparable reduction in the VAS score for both groups treated with MENS and TENS therapy. Conclusion Compared to TENS, MENS provides quicker and more effective pain relief. Paresthesia and tingling are two adverse effects of TENS that are not present with MENS. However, MENS and TENS are equally helpful at treating masticatory muscle discomfort that is both acute and chronic, as well as improving mouth opening.

摘要

背景

一系列影响颌面部肌肉和/或颞下颌关节的疾病被称为颞下颌关节紊乱病(TMDs)。近80%的普通人群受到TMDs的影响,其中48%的人张口困难且肌肉疼痛。目的:比较经皮电刺激神经疗法(TENS)和微电流神经刺激疗法(MENS)缓解咀嚼肌不适的效果。方法:第一组和第二组又各自分为两组,每组30人(A组和B组),以及C亚组和D亚组。第一组的受试者接受TENS治疗20分钟,A亚组和B亚组的频率分别为0 - 5和5 - 5,C亚组和D亚组的视觉模拟评分(VAS)分别为1 - 5和6 - 10。第二组的受试者接受MENS治疗20分钟,C亚组和D亚组分别与A亚组和B亚组接受相同的频率和VAS评分。所有个体每天以相当的频率和时长接受治疗,持续五天。结果:接受MENS治疗的D亚组疼痛明显减轻;然而,对于A亚组和C亚组,接受MENS和TENS治疗的两组VAS评分均有类似程度的降低。结论:与TENS相比,MENS能更快、更有效地缓解疼痛。TENS有感觉异常和刺痛这两种不良反应,而MENS没有。然而,MENS和TENS在治疗急慢性咀嚼肌不适以及改善张口方面同样有效。
